Output 1e93f17bd11e134df2c6164204cf3b005e8f70b3ffa4cbacde1eb94ca5517680:1

value
3950846989
script pubkey
OP_0 OP_PUSHBYTES_20 7ab893f4c1b67394a280a86cf63d933053f8ad0a
address
tb1q02uf8axpkeeefg5q4pk0v0vnxpfl3tg2jmx93l
transaction
1e93f17bd11e134df2c6164204cf3b005e8f70b3ffa4cbacde1eb94ca5517680
confirmations
110275
spent
true